Informationen zum Autor Joel D. Ernst is the Director of the Division of Infectious Diseases and Professor of Medicine and Microbiology at the New York University School of Medicine. Olle Stendahl is Professor of Medical Microbiology at Linkoping University! Sweden. Klappentext This book provides up-to-date information on the crucial interaction of pathogenic bacteria and professional phagocytes, the host cells whose purpose is to ingest, kill, and digest bacteria in defense against infection. The introductory chapters focus on the receptors used by professional phagocytes to recognize and phagocytose bacteria, and the signal transduction events that are essential for phagocytosis of bacteria. Subsequent chapters discuss specific bacterial pathogens and the strategies they use in confronting professional phagocytes. This outstanding overview of current knowledge will be invaluable to graduate students and researchers. Zusammenfassung An overview of current knowledge regarding the mechanisms of phagocytosis and how specific pathogenic bacteria avoid or exploit these mechanisms. The receptors and signal transduction events involved are discussed! followed by examples of specific bacterial pathogens and the strategies they use in confronting professional phagocytes.
